Actor Ioan Gruffudd and wife Bianca Wallace are officially parents.
Wallace took to Instagram on Nov. 27 to share a Thanksgiving surprise with her fans and followers after giving birth to her first child — a baby girl — with Gruffudd seven months after the couple tied the knot.
“November was a biggie,” she wrote in the caption of her post, which included photos of a “preemie” onesie and a pacifier sitting in a hospital bassinet.
“Completely and totally in love with our tiny little angel,” she added in the caption. “Extremely grateful this Thanksgiving.”

In the post, Wallace confirmed that the baby’s name is Mila Mae and she was born on Nov. 2 — one month before her original due date, Dec. 2.
She further confirmed in a comment that the baby’s name is pronounced MEE-la.
Mila, the 33rd most popular girl’s name in 2024, per the Social Security Administration, derives from the Slavic word milŭ, meaning “gracious” or “dear,” according to Behind the Name.
“You can thank Daddy Gruffudd for the name,” Ioan Gruffudd’s wife added in the comment. “We love it so much too!!”
Wallace also shared a photo of a decorative keepsake that read “Babi Newydd” and “Gyda Chariad,” meaning “new baby” and “with love” in Welsh, respectively.
Gruffudd is a Welsh actor who was born in Aberdare, Wales.

Wallace also shared a photo of her baby’s umbilical cord keepsake from Mommy Made Encapsulation.
The company, owned by Juliane Corona, preserves the baby’s umbilical cord by dehydrating it in the shape of a heart and dipping it in gold chrome to create a unique pendant that moms can keep forever.
Wallace also had her placenta and umbilical cord dyed and stamped onto a poster, per the photos.

Mommy Made Encapsulation went viral two weeks ago for doing the same thing for Cardi B, who welcomed her first child with NFL player Stefon Diggs on Nov. 4.
Megan Fox, Vanessa Hudgens, Allison Kuch, Kristen Doute and Liane V Benjamin have also had their umbilical cord preserved through Mommy Made Encapsulation.
Wallace, who voices Kanga in “A Winnie-the-Pooh Christmas,” and Gruffudd, best known for his roles in “Titanic” and “Fantastic Four,” confirmed their relationship in October 2021.
